Airplanes and Attitudes

Yowzers. What a day. It hasn’t been a ” bad ” day we have just had several challenges through out the day.  Not every day can be perfect and ” what is perfect?”  Today was one of those days that as a teacher and a strong believer in conscious discipline I have to literally stop and take a deep breath.

We can handle this .  ( Debbie doing the balloon. )

Today we started talking about airplanes since we are visiting the airport tonight.  We made airplanes  !

 

We also spent more than our scheduled time outside

today taking full advantage of the amazing weather.
